'Good Trouble Lives On' march for civil and human rights in Boston
epa12243833 Demonstrators take part in a march and rally for democracy and freedom to honor the legacy of Civil Rights icon and former Congressman John Lewis, as part of a nationwide protest of the recent policies of the Trump administration, in Boston, Massachusetts, USA, 17 July 2025. This event is part of the 'Good Trouble Lives On' nationwide day of peaceful, nonviolent action inspired by John Lewis? call to make 'good trouble, necessary trouble,' and to show support for workers, voting rights, free and fair elections, the civil rights of Black, Indigenous, immigrant, LGBTQIA, and transgender communities, as well as the end of ICE raids.
